Jared and his brother and friends are led away from the tower and all the people with their confounded language. The Lord had told them that He would lead them to a land of promise. The people camped by the seashore (not yet having arrived in the promised land that the Lord had told them about) for four years. At this point, the brother of Jared had a unique experience.
"And it came to pass at the end of four years that the Lord came again unto the brother of Jared, and stood in a cloud and talked with him. And for the space of three hours did the Lord talk with the brother of Jared, and chastened him because he remembered not to call upon the name of the Lord." (Ether 2:14)
Can you imagine? Sitting and talking with the Lord for 3 hours! To top it off, I guess the brother of Jared had been slacking in saying his prayers, so the Lord chastened him for it.
I guess I would like to point out that the Lord still came and talked with him for 3 hours. You don't spend time with Him like that if you are super wicked. I think about the amount of faith the brother of Jared had, to ask the Lord to not confound their language and everything. It can happen to the best of people, to just begin to neglect to call upon God.
I know that I can do better in my effort to pray, to really communicate with God. This is a sin of omission, and it's super easy to fall into that trap. To just get relaxed about things that we do, or rather, don't do, that we should be doing. It's good to have reminders and things to make sure we are doing what we're supposed to.
